Executive director: Head Start office abruptly shut down
The Region 5 office of Head Start was abruptly closed and all federal staff were placed on administrative leave until June without warning, according to the Michigan Head Start Association.

On the topic of the FASSE grant from @cufancss.bsky.social and @ncssnetwork.bsky.social : This fund dates back to the 1960s and was originally financed by a bequest from the estate of Mary Kelty, third woman president of NCSS, who was killed in a car wreck in 1964.
